Understanding Posture and Neck Pain
When it comes to neck discomfort, recognizing the duty of stance is critical. Your posture considerably impacts the placement of your back and the general health and wellness of your neck. When you sit or stand appropriately, your body keeps a natural contour, which can stop unneeded strain on your neck muscular tissues.
You mightn't realize it, yet how you position your head, shoulders, and back can either minimize or aggravate discomfort. When you're hunched over a computer system or looking down at your phone, you're most likely positioning excessive stress on your neck. This forward head stance can result in muscular tissue tension and discomfort.
You need to be conscious of how your body aligns throughout the day and make modifications as essential. Easy techniques can aid improve your position. As an example, guarantee your workstation is ergonomically established, permitting your display to be at eye level.

Common Stance Mistakes
Many individuals unwittingly make common position mistakes that can result in neck pain and pain. One of the most regular mistakes is slouching while resting or standing. When you hunch your shoulders or lean forward, you strain your neck muscular tissues, creating stress that can escalate right into discomfort.
One more error is looking down at your gadgets for prolonged durations. Whether you're scrolling on your phone or working at a computer system, turning your head downward puts extra stress on your neck.
Furthermore, you may find yourself craning your neck to obtain a better view, particularly in jampacked rooms or during conferences. This forward head position can contribute to chronic neck discomfort with time.
Poor ergonomic setups additionally enter into play. If your workstation isn't lined up appropriately, you may be forced into abnormal positions that can set off pain.

Chiropractic Tips for Renovation
Improving your position and lowering neck pain can be dramatically helped by chiropractic treatment. Routine check outs to a chiropractic specialist can assist straighten your spine, which usually reduces stress in the neck. They'll examine your stance and provide customized modifications that advertise better alignment.
You should also include certain workouts into your routine. Strengthening your neck and top back muscular tissues can boost your posture. Basic exercises like chin tucks and shoulder blade squeezes can make a big difference.
In addition, extending your neck and upper back can soothe rigidity that adds to pain.
Take notice of your work area. Guarantee your computer screen is at eye level, and your chair sustains your lower back. When resting, maintain your feet level on the floor and your shoulders loosened up.
Lastly, be mindful of your practices. If you spend a lot of time on your phone, hold it at eye degree rather than bending your neck down.
